Thaxted Festival: Ignas Maknickas (Harlow)
Thaxted Festival is delighted to present Ignas Maknickas in Great Dunmow, as part of its Developing Artists Programme.
The programme provides a platform for professional musicians and composers at the earlier stages of their careers.
Through it, we are able to bring outstanding musicians to a wide public within our summer Festival season in Thaxted, as well as through our outreach events in other locations.
Ignas Maknickas is a 2023 Young Classical Artists Trust winner and has performed in numerous competitions. He took first prize at the XIX Fryderyk Chopin Piano Competition for Youth in Szafarnia, first prize at the XX Piano Competition ‘Young Virtuoso’ in Zagreb, third prize at the Aarhus Piano Competition and, in 2021, was the semi-finalist of the Vendome Prize.
In the same year, he received ‘The Queen’s Commendation for Excellence’ as the highest-scoring graduate of London’s Royal Academy of Music.
In September 2021 he commenced the Master of Arts programme at the RAM on a full scholarship, studying with Professor Joanna MacGregor CBE.
